
Italian manufacturer Ranieri-International Boats and Inflatable Boats recently announced it that it tapped Madison Bay Holdings to establish a dealer network in the U.S., Canada and the Caribbean.
Based in Sovarato, Italy, Ranieri manufactures fiberglass boats from 19 to 37 feet including cruisers, center consoles and walkaround models. The company also produces rigid hull inflatables measuring 12 to 45 feet.
Founded in Seattle, Wash., by Ricardo Ruelos, Madison Bay Holdings moved to Sarasota, Fla., in 2015. The company has worked with MasterCraft Boat Company, Eliminator Boats, Fountain Powerboats, Century and others. Ruelos also served as vice president of Sealine Yachts and was CEO of Westship World Yachts.
“Over the past year, we have worked closely with Ricardo and Madison Bay Holdings to start building the foundation for the expansion of a select dealer network for Ranieri-International in North America,” Salvatore and Antonio Ranieri said in a statement. “Although Ranieri-International has an extensive dealer throughout Europe and other areas in the world, Ricardo has guided us through the process of establishing a valued dealer network in North America.”
Added Ruelos in the statement, “I am pleased to have the opportunity to represent Ranieri-International and work with the Ranieri family and our valued dealers. Throughout my career, I have had the pleasure to work with many boat companies that have been family owned and operated as this is the foundation and legacy of the marine industry.”
